Hackers are constantly evolving, exploiting new vulnerabilities and dwelling in small business environments—until they meet Huntress.
Huntress enables IT providers and resellers to stop hidden threats that sneak past preventive security tools. Founded by former NSA Cyber Operators—and backed by a team of Security researchers—we help our partners protect their customers and take the fight directly to hackers.
FAQs
- When was Huntress founded?
- Huntress was founded in 2015.
- Who is the CEO of Huntress?
- Kyle Hanslovan is the CEO.
- What industries or markets does Huntress operate in?
- Huntress operates in the following markets: Cybersecurity, Endpoint Protection, Identity Protection, IT Services, Small Business Security, Threat Detection, Security Research, Managed Security Services, IT Resellers, and Preventive Security Tools.
- How many employees does Huntress have?
- Huntress has 201-500 employees.
- Where does Huntress have employees?
- Huntress has employees in United States, Australia, and United Kingdom.
- Is Huntress hiring?
- Yes, Huntress has 25 open remote jobs.
- Does Huntress support remote work or working from home?
- Yes, Huntress is a remote-friendly company.
